Chilean Ajiaco

Entradas
1 hour
4 Servings

Ingredients

400 grams of Beef steak

20 milliliters of Olive oil

2 Garlic cloves

300 grams of Sliced onion

100 grams of Julienne-cut carrot

50 grams of Julienne red bell pepper

700 grams of Peeled potatoes, cut into chunks

3 liters of Beef broth

6 Eggs

Finely chopped cilantro

Merquén

Cooking salt

Aji de color (chili pepper paste)

Ground cumin

Dried oregano

Bay leaves

Preparation

Step 1 : Shred the beef steak and set aside.

Step 2 : Sauté the onion with the garlic in olive oil.

Step 3 : Add the red pepper and carrot. Season with salt, aji de color, cumin, oregano, and bay leaves. Incorporate the chopped potatoes and sauté for a few minutes.

Step 4 : Add the beef along with the sautéed vegetables and potatoes. Pour in the beef broth and cook over low heat for 20 minutes.

Step 5 : Before serving, heat part of the broth in a low saucepan and poach the eggs one at a time, making sure not to boil to prevent breaking them.

Step 6 : Place the vegetables and shredded meat at the bottom of the plate, then gently add the poached eggs on top, and cover everything with the hot broth.

Step 7 : Sprinkle with cilantro and merquén.
